Headnotes / Summary
S.491
Detenu, aged about 14 years, after her recovery from the respondent expressed her desire to live with the petitioner, her real paternal-grandmother
Detenue was accordingly set at liberty with the permission to live with the petitioner according to her wish.
Judgment & Decree
S.491
Detenu, aged about 14 years, after her recovery from the respondent expressed her desire to live with the petitioner, her real paternal-grandmother
Detenue was accordingly set at liberty with the permission to live with the petitioner according to her wish. Miss Christine Brass v. Dr. Javed lqbal PLD 19981 Pesh. 110 and Mrs. Moselle Said v. Khawaja Ahmad Said and others PLD 1957 (W.P.) Kar. 50 ref. M. Hassan Mahmood Sayal and Muhammad Ozair Chughtai for Petitioner. Muhammad Khalid AM for Respondents. Mst. Sofia Latif the alleged detenue has been recovered from the respondents and produced by the bailiff of this Court today. She is about 14 years old because admittedly she was born on 11-10-1979. Respondent is U.S. citizen. The alleged detenue when asked categorically stated that she wants to live with the present petitioner who is 'her real paternal-grandmother. The respondent has placed on record a judgment delivered by Circuit Court for .Montgomery County, Maryland, according to which the custody of the two minor children including the alleged detenue has been ordered to be delivered to the respondent by the said Court. Learned counsel for the petitioner has referred two judgments reported as Miss Christine Brass v. Dr. Javed lqbal PLD 19981 Pesh. 110 and Mrs. Moselle Said v. Khawaja Ahmad Said and others PLD 1957 (W.P.) Kar. 50 and argued that the foreign said judgment has no material bearing upon the right of the petitioner to seek restoration of custody of the minor to her as she was illegally removed from her custody and detained by the respondent No.
3. The petitioner has placed on record a judgment delivered by another Court of America through which the respondent was convicted for drug abuse.
2. Since the alleged detenue has expressed her desire to live with the petitioner therefore, she is set at liberty. She may go and live with the IA petitioner as she wants. Disposed of accordingly. N.H.Q./B-79/L Order accordingly.
